14:22 — Fixturesmith v3.1 deployed; test-data factory began emitting duplicate sequence IDs under parallel runs. 14:35 — CI for Larkfield repos turned red; seed collisions confirmed in the factory's shared counter. 14:48 — Rolled back to v3.0; greens restored. 15:10 — Root cause: counter moved from thread-local to module scope in refactor. Fix pending review; patch adds per-worker namespacing and a regression test. Reviewer should verify the failing build against the trace below.

pipeline stamp: htk9_6ce9d33c5

## Configuration

After the N+1 fix in the Gildervane GraphQL layer, the batching loader is on by default — set BATCH_LOADER=0 only if resolvers start returning stale rows. Cache TTL lives in LOADER_TTL_MS. The loader's metrics push to Hawkspur needs credentials, and the token for that is set on the line below.

sealed setting: ARCHIVE_KEY3=8d0

## Runbook: Timezone handling in report exports (Ledgermist)

Support team: when a customer reports that exported report totals don't match the dashboard, first check the workspace timezone setting versus the export scheduler's timezone. Ledgermist exports bucket rows by the scheduler's zone, so a workspace set to a different offset will show shifted day boundaries — this is expected, not data loss. Confirm the customer is on the build that added explicit zone stamps to export headers. That build is identified by the token below.

build token for kagaf-hahof: htk14_9d3d4d26d7d8de

**TICKET-2417: Load-test vault sealed — Cartwheel checkout flow**

For new team members: the credentials vault used by our Cartwheel checkout load tests sealed itself after three failed token renewals on Friday night. This blocks all synthetic purchase runs. Please verify the scheduler is paused before unsealing, since queued tests will fire immediately once access returns. When prompted by the unseal tool, enter the recovery passphrase given on the following line.

unlock words, yawig-kagef: gordor-holvan-ulaael-pramir-ulaiel-tamdor